The quotient of a number x and -1.5 = 21

Answer:

The value of x is -31.5.

Step-by-step explanation:

Quotient means the result of dividing a number by another number. For example, the quotient of 4 and 2 is 2.

The information provided in this question can be represented with this equation:

= 21

In order to determine the value of x, multiply both sides of the equation by -1.5.

x = 21 x - 1.5

x = -31.5
